AbstractIntroduction: Genetics, cellular and molecular medicines are cutting-edge sciences and technologies that play an important role in improving human health and quality of life. In addition, medical and biological sciences have clearly shown that the onset of diseases differs from person to person due to their different genetic profiles and variations in molecular basis. Therefore, it is feasible that patients respond differently to a single treatment. Personalized medicine is a new field of medicine aims to tailor medical treatments to the individual characteristics of patients. In this review, in addition to genomics and personalized medicine, we touch upon common techniques in this field and the future of personalized medicine. With this development, people can get more information about the possibility of contracting diseases like cancer and early-stage treatments as well as personalized therapies based on their genetic characteristics. Technologies, such as mutation detection in the genome, microarrays or microchips, and next-generation sequencing of the human genome, have not only made molecular detection better and easier but also facilitated the integration of molecular detection with targeted drug delivery for the development of novel personalized treatment.en
